It was probably one of my best decision to join this college for my creative growth. The level of industry exposure here has been pretty great if i have to compare it with my BSc days. The professors here are genuinely impressive, they are pretty knowledgeable and have a lot of practical insights. Having faculty who actually understand current animation pipelines makes learning complex software and production workflows much easier. Overall, it’s a supportive, hands-on environment that really prepares you to push your skills and build a standout professional portfolio.
As I didn't opt for this semister internship I can't really give an conclusion but from what I have seen the college did it's best to provide anyone who wants to do internship. The professor also seemed to be very helpful for those looking for internships.
The total cost was around 5-6 lakhs. I would say it was worth it for me as i didnt have the same given opportunity and teachings back in my Bsc course. I'm definitely learning more so it's definitely worth the money.

The Online B.Com offered by JAIN (Deemed-to-be University) is a UGC-entitled program from a university accredited with NAAC A++ . It is designed for students and working professionals who need the flexibility of online learning.
